Jethro Tull's 'Elegy': A Wordless Symphony Exploring the Ethereal Beauty
In the world of instrumental music, there are few compositions that capture the imagination quite like Jethro Tull's 'Elegy.' This breathtaking piece showcases the virtuosity of the band's musicians, with its enchanting flute and electric guitar melodies leading the way. Far from an ordinary song, 'Elegy' is a testament to the power of music to evoke deep emotions without the need for lyrics.
Interestingly, 'Elegy' found its way into the hearts of many South Korean listeners, as it was once used as the signature tune for a late-night music radio program. This exposure led to the piece becoming widely recognized and appreciated in the country. The captivating beauty of 'Elegy' made it the perfect choice for a signature tune, inviting listeners to experience its emotional depth and narrative.

Ian Anderson, the man behind the flute, is a founding member of Jethro Tull and a true virtuoso. His talents extend beyond his flute mastery, as he is also a skilled vocalist, guitarist, and songwriter. Throughout his extensive career, Anderson has earned a reputation for his captivating stage presence and unique blend of rock, folk, and classical influences. His performance in 'Elegy' is a prime example of his unparalleled skill and creativity as a musician.
